Chicago-based artist Michael Thompson creates unique kites crafted from split bamboo frames covered with stretched muslin and a collage of vintage Asian ephemera - including fragments of fabric, scrolls, drawings, and books collected during his travels. In "Water Series IV,” panels of teal and indigo leach into their surroundings with captivating irregularity. Contrasted by a neutral field of gestural calligraphy, the cool watercolors ebb and flow across the saturated canvas like puddles of water. At the kite's center is a line of poetry by the Song-era poet Su Shi reading "harmonious time, abundant years," a sentiment conveying notions of peace and prosperity.

Thompson has earned an international reputation for his kite works, an engrossing project initiated by the artist more than a decade ago.
